According to 2026 Q2 report, Richard Pzena doesn't hold any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M) shares. To date, the estimated cost basis is nearly $57.49 for "buy" trades and estimated average "sell" price is $57.49. Pzena Investment Management first purchased ADM in 2025 Q4, initially acquiring 4,842 shares. Since the initial investment in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M), Pzena Investment Management has made 1 more transaction.

When did Richard Pzena sell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M)?

Richard Pzena sold off the entire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M) position in 2026 Q1.

When did Richard Pzena buy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M)?

Richard Pzena first invested in Archer-Daniels-Midland Company (ADM) in 2025 Q4 at the reported quarter-end price of $57.49 per share.
